ENV-003k — Record Controlled Starting State
Statement
Before each Test Execution, the DIDO-TE SHALL record the validated controlled starting state as Evidence.

Rationale
Recording the validated controlled starting state preserves the conditions under which a Test Execution began.
The record identifies the applied Baseline, Configuration values, participating Nodes, Test Objects, provisioned Test Resources, loaded Test Inputs, communication relationships, applicable Constraints, residual-state dispositions, and validation result.
This Evidence supports interpretation of the resulting Test Results, investigation of differences, Reproducibility, Comparability, and Traceability.

Verification
Verification confirms that:
-
The DIDO-TE records the validated controlled starting state before each Test Execution.
-
The record identifies the applicable Test Environment, Test Definition, and Test Execution.
-
The record identifies the applied Baseline and Configuration values.
-
The record identifies the participating Nodes and Test Objects and their initial states.
-
The record identifies the provisioned Test Resources and loaded Test Inputs.
-
The record identifies the established communication relationships.
-
The record identifies the applicable Constraints and their evaluation results.
-
The record identifies detected residual state and its removal or isolation disposition.
-
The record contains the starting-state validation result and each identified difference.
-
The record contains the time of validation and the identity of the validating process or responsible actor.
-
The record protects the integrity of the recorded Evidence.
-
The DIDO-TE maintains Traceability among the starting-state Evidence, its constituent records, the controlled descriptive information, Test Environment, Test Definition, and Test Execution.
-
Missing, incomplete, inconsistent, altered, unsupported, or untraceable starting-state Evidence constitutes nonconformance with this requirement.
